Kolkata: Mohun Bagan’s star striker Jeje Lalpekhlua arrived in the city today evening. Jeje, who was adjudged the Best Indian footballer by the All India Football Federation will join the practice tomorrow at the club ground. The diminutive striker arrived from his hometown Mozoram in an Air India flight.

He looked quite excited with the fact that he will be joining his old teammates at the Mariners. On being asked what his target will be this season for Mohun Bagan, a confident Jeje said, “My target will be to win back the I League again for Mohun Bagan.”

Jeje has been in tremendous form this season. The 25-year-old footballer from Mizoram Jeje has made rapid strides in Indian football since making his international debut in 2012.

The Mariners have the best strike force in the country at the moment. With Jeje, Balwant and Duffy the Federation Cup champions will look forward to the trio to win matches for them in the forthcoming I League.

On being asked whether he will get enough time to adjust to the combinations, Jeje commented, “I am absolutely fit to play from the first match. It is up to the coach to decide whether he will keep me in the playing eleven or not.”

Mohun Bagan ended up as the runners last season in I League. The Mariners came a close second in the league. Jeje, who was part of the Bagan squad for the last couple of seasons will look to end up winning the title this season.

According to Jeje, “I would like to start from where I left season. I would like to give my best for the club.”

On the other hand Mohun Bagan has announced the signing of Brazilian defender Eduardo Soares Ferreira for I-League 2016-17 . He started his youth career at Fluminese an elite Brazilian club playing in the  Campeonato Brasileiro Série A, his professional career started in the year 2005-2006 at Primavera which participates in the  Campeonato Paulista Série B2. Since then the player never looked back as he excelled to high ranks and played for numerous clubs across different.

Before joining FC Pune City in this year edition of ISL 3 he was plying his trade at Esteghlal Khuzestan F.C. which participates in the Iranian Gulf Pro-League. The player performed well and received appreciation for his clinical defending for FC Pune City this year.

Eduardo Quoted: “I am excited to join Mohun Bagan one of oldest Football in Asia, it will be a good experience for me to play as the club has successfully won the I-League and Federation Cup in last couple of season. I look forward to contribute and win a major title with the Club”.

Eduardo will be arriving tomorrow early morning.
